Fuel cell vehicle

An object is to supply a sufficient amount of air to a fuel cell stack in a fuel cell vehicle when the fuel cell stack is mounted below a floor, the fuel cell stack configured to draw in air through an intake duct and discharge air to the exterior through an exhaust duct. An air introduction surface (26) faces upward or downward in a vehicle upper and lower direction, an intake passage portion (30) of the intake duct (28) extends along the air introduction surface (26) and vertical walls (31, 32) of left and right end portions of the fuel cell stack (11) while a pair of air introduction ports (33, 34) opens in left and right end portions of the intake passage portion (30), and an exhaust passage portion (39) of the exhaust duct (29) extends along an air discharge surface (27) and vertical walls (40, 41) of front and rear end portions of the fuel cell stack (11) while a pair of air discharge ports (42, 43) opens in front and rear end portions of the exhaust passage portion (39).

Multi-phase multi-pole electric machine
09595859 · 2017-03-14 ·

A multi-phase multi-pole electric machine attached to a vehicle. The multi-phase multi-pole electric machine includes rotor, stator with five phase windings, machine controller, and torque sensors. The machine controller controls the flow of current. The torque sensors senses the torque exerted by the vehicle and transmits the information to the machine controller. The machine controller provides four degree of control through injection of five phase currents and thus providing higher torque.

Battery device, control method, and electric vehicle

This technology relates to a battery device, a control method, and an electric vehicle capable of providing a highly secure anti-theft function. A battery outputs DC power through a power line, a reader/writer communicates by outputting a high-frequency signal through the power line to read authentication information of an electronic device when the electronic device is connected to the battery through the power line, a microcomputer stores the read authentication information and controls the battery when first connection to the electronic device is performed, and performs an authentication process of the electronic device based on the read authentication information and the authentication information stored in the first connection and controls the battery according to a result of the authentication process of the electronic device when second or subsequent connection to the electronic device is performed. This technology may be applied to the battery device mounted on a power-assisted bicycle, for example.
